ORDER OF CONFESSION AND FORGIVENESS
Long-expected God, we confess that we look to ourselves for the peace and security only you can provide. We reach for weapons of technology and harmful policies, reluctant to release our grip on ways of power and war. We become impatient while waiting and weary of keeping awake. Free us from self-reliance, and teach us to live in harmony with our neighbors. Increase our trust in God’s timing, and awaken us to your advent among us, that we may abound in the hope you have promised. Amen.
God judges us not as we deserve, but according to God’s own righteousness. ☩ You are freed and forgiven, saved by grace, and ready to welcome the Savior.
Amen.

PRAYERS of INTERCESSION
In our waiting and watching, we come to you in prayer, O God, trusting your promise to renew the church, the nations, and the whole creation. A brief silence.
God of the people, we come seeking wisdom and instruction. Uphold and strengthen lay leaders, teachers, deacons, pastors, and bishops. Teach us your ways and lead us in your paths. God of grace, hear our prayer.
God of the earth, we seek your goodness in the grandeur of creation. Empower us to care for forests and oceans, as we see you in the world around us. God of grace, hear our prayer.
God of the nations, grant wisdom to leaders, judges, and mediators. Cast out words of hate and transform them into words for building up community. Remake implements of war to sow peace. God of grace, hear our prayer.
God of healing, bring comfort and strength. We pray for kindred and companions who are ill or despairing (especially those on our prayer list and those affected by HIV and AIDS as we remember World AIDS Day). Surround all with care and consolation. God of grace, hear our prayer.
God of new possibilities, when addiction wounds, jealousy tears down, and relationships fray, show us how to journey with one another. Nurture therapists, counselors, and sponsors in their care for others. God of grace, hear our prayer.
God of all time, build up our faith that our lives would reflect your grace. At the last, bring us with all the saints to your holy city where peace and goodness make a home. God of grace, hear our prayer.
Draw near to us, O God, as we commend all for whom we pray, trusting in your mercy through Jesus Christ, Emmanuel. Amen.
